$23 an hour is $47,840 a year

At 40 hours per week for 52 weeks (2,080 hours), $23 per hour works out to $47,840 a year โ€” $3,986.67 a month, $1,840.00 biweekly, and $920.00 a week before taxes. This is squarely in the range of skilled service, logistics, healthcare-support, and trade roles โ€” the wage band where overtime hours and pre-tax benefits make the biggest relative difference.

Overtime changes the math fast

Overtime at time-and-a-half pays $34.50/hour. Five OT hours a week lifts annual gross to $56,810; ten OT hours reaches $65,780 โ€” $17,940 more than the straight-time year. And through 2028, up to $12,500 of the overtime premium is deductible from federal income tax under the OBBBA โ€” see our guide to the new deductions.

How this compares

$23/hour is 3.2ร— the federal minimum wage ($15,080/year) and below median U.S. individual earnings of roughly $60,000. Compared with adjacent rates: $22/hour earns $45,760 and $24/hour earns $49,920 โ€” each $1/hour of raise is worth $2,080 a year.

How much is $23 an hour after taxes?

A single filer taking the standard deduction keeps about $40,619 of $47,840 in 2026 โ€” federal income tax of $3,561 (effective rate 7.4%) plus $3,660 in Social Security and Medicare. State income tax, where it applies, reduces it further.

What salary is equal to $23 an hour?

$47,840 per year, using the standard 2,080-hour work year (40 hours ร— 52 weeks). With two weeks of unpaid time off it's $46,000.
